Minami-Moriya Station (南守谷駅, Minami-Moriya-eki) is a train station in Moriya, Ibaraki Prefecture, Japan.

Lines

Minami-Moriya Station is a station on the Kantō Railway’s Jōsō Line, and is located 7.4 km from the official starting point of the line at Toride Station.

Station layout

The station has a single elevated island platform with the station building underneath. The station is unattended.

History

Minami-Moriya Station was opened on 15 November 1960 as a station on the Jōsō-Tsukuba Railway, which became the Kanto Railway in 1965.
